(Credit: Imago) Sun 17 May 2026 13:51, UK Manchester City appear to have settled on the appointment of Enzo Maresca as the replacement for Pep Guardiola this summer. The Spanish boss has been heavily linked with a potential departure from the Etihad Stadium, amid sustained speculation that this could be his final year at the helm of the Citizens.
Guardiola’s future at City now appears to have been settled, with Sacha Tavolieri reporting via his X account on Sunday that “barring a last-minute twist,” the 55-year-old will be moving on. Links with Maresca to come in as his replacement have grown ever stronger in recent months, and it is now understood that “everything is in place” for the former Chelsea man to take over.
